Position Summary
Project Manager, Planning & Redevelopment
North York General Hospital (NYGH) is continuing its planning process in anticipation of renovation and renewal of its facilities. NYGH is seeking a person to manage the successful delivery of both large and small scale design, construction projects, handover and occupancy phases of work. You have excellent organizational, time-management, consensus building and negotiation skills. You also have excellent verbal and written communication skills. You have the ability to multi-task, deal with change and to coordinate resources. This position supports the Hospital’s academic mandate by advancing care through teaching and learning and/or transforming care through research and innovation. This position contributes to the shared responsibility of ensuring health and safety policies are followed to provide for a healthy environment for patients, staff, physicians, volunteers and families.
On a practical level, you will
Collaborate with the NYGH Planning Dept to create successful Project Implementation Plans
Lead project teams, including hospital staff and consultants, in the planning, design and implementation of projects in accordance with hospital requirements and applicable codes, standards, and pertinent legislation
Support the consultants and the hospital in seeking Municipal and Ministry of Health (MOH) project approval
Undertake the responsibility to make timely decisions and maintain schedule and budgets
Work with the support of other hospital staff to ensure that the contractor is fulfilling their contractual obligations to abide by all hospitals policies, (i.e. Infection Prevention and Control)
Provide leadership and guidance to project team during all stages of the project lifecycle (Concept through Close-Out)
Conduct and attend project team meetings (Steering Committee, Project Working Groups)
Develop, tracks and maintain project documentation during all stages of the project lifecycle (Concept through Close-Out)
Work with contractors to ensure the safe and successful delivery of construction of the projects, with consideration for constructability, phasing, infection prevention and control and other applicable codes, standards and legislation
Maintain current knowledge on all project related issues regarding procurement, practices, and risks
Assist as required in the Request for Qualifications (RFQ), Request for Proposal (RFP), and Request for Tender (RFT) documents for consulting and construction services
Ensure project deliverables are met on time, within budget, scope and according contractual obligations and hospital policies
Prepare regular reporting on project scope, costs and schedule throughout the project lifecycle
**Qualifications**:
A university degree or college diploma in engineering, architecture, project management, construction management with equivalent combination of education and experience required
Minimum 3 years of experience in a healthcare setting in a role related to capital project planning and delivery
Minimum 3 years of experience managing multiple simultaneous projects
In-depth knowledge of hospital operations and management, and health facility design preferred
Demonstrated leadership and consensus building skills, with a lens of strong patient/family focus
Highly effective interpersonal and communication (verbal and written) skills, combined with excellent organizational skills, with demonstrated ability to achieve outcomes
Strong people/project leadership skills, with ability to give feedback
Understanding of applicable legislation, regulations and standards, i.e. Ontario Building Code, CSA Z8000
Understanding of Ministry of Health and Long-term Care Capital Approvals Process
Experience with the planning, design and construction of Long Term Care Homes would be an asset
Project Management Professional (PMP) designation would be an asset
Proficient in computers and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int, Excel, MS Project, Adobe Acrobat
Bilingualism in French/English an asset
